MIDTOWN — Cypress Street Pint & Plate will host its eighth-annual end-of-summer pig roast on Saturday, August 29. From 11 a.m. to 5 p.m., the restaurant will dish out whole-hog barbecue, SweetWater brews from the SweetWater beer truck, and King of Pops popsicles. Stevie Q & The Sandals will provide the live tunes. General admission, with the option to purchase food and beer, is free, and VIP tickets, which come with a limited-edition Cypress Street pig roast t-shirt, one SweetWater beer, one popsicle, and pig roast artwork from Chris Neuenschwander, are $25 and available online. BUCKHEAD — Atlanta expat and Top Chef lifer Richard Blais is coming to the Flip Burger Boutique on Roswell Road to sign copies of his cookbook Try This at Home: Recipes from My Head to Your Plate. Blais will be at the restaurant on Sunday, August 9, from 1 p.m. to 3 p.m., and his book will be available for $30. [EaterWire]
BUCKHEAD — To celebrate fake holiday National Oyster Day on Wednesday, August 5, The Big Ketch Saltwater Grill will offer its oyster happy hour prices all day. From 11 a.m. to 10 p.m., bivalves on the half shell will be served half-price, and a few limited-time oyster dishes will be available, as well. [EaterWire]
